José María Serrano Cornelio is a skilled Solar Project Engineer at DNV, specializing in Solar and Storage advisory projects, particularly focusing on Technical Due Diligences. With experience as a Performance Supervisor and Performance Engineer at CTG Latam, José María managed the performance analysis of a 535 MW solar portfolio. Previous roles include O&M Plant Technician with X-ELIO, where monitoring and reporting on the Navojoa Solar PV plant's KPIs were key responsibilities. José María also contributed to innovative energy projects at IER, UNAM, and served as an assistant researcher at the National level. Educational qualifications include a Master of Engineering in Solar Energy from the Instituto de Energías Renovables - UNAM, further studies at the University of Arizona and FH Aachen University of Applied Sciences, and a degree in Mechanical-Electric Engineering from Universidad Veracruzana.
